Kathmandu - Japan has made history with the election of Sanae Takaichi as the country’s first female prime minister, bre...
Kathmandu - Japan is on the verge of making political history as lawmakers prepare to elect the country’s first-ever fem...
Kathmandu - In a bizarre and shocking case of human trafficking, 22 individuals posing as members of a fake Pakistani na...